We’ve enhanced our Software-Defined Radio (SDR) receiver Fobos SDR with new features and improvements. Here are the updates:

  • 8 lines GPO port (general purpose output – software-controlled digital outputs) added to control an external equipments.
  • Passband frequency response improved.
  • Antenna inputs electricity static discharge protection added.
  • Parasitics influence minimized and noise resistance improved.
  • The low-pass filters for HF1 and HF2 inputs designed with cutoff frequency of 24 MHz.
  • USB data link stability improved.

 

The main features of our NEW Fobos SDR we are proud of: 

  • Broad main frequency range: continuous 25 MHz to 6 GHz coverage.
  • Two auxiliary coherent direct sampling channels: 100 kHz to 25 MHz coverage, suitable for diversity reception, correlation and phase-difference direction finding.
  • Overall frequency coverage 100 kHz to 6 GHz.
  • 50 MHz sampling bandwidth: 50 M samples per second IQ rate or 2×25 M samples per second direct sampling rate.
  • High-quality signal conversion: double heterodyne, 14-bit sample depth analog to digital conversion (ADC).
  • Continuous data stream: digitized data with no dropped buffers, uninterrupted recording and real-time analysis.
  • All the features simultaneously, no “either-or”: 50 MHz rate, and 14-bit ADC and continuous data stream within continuous frequency coverage.

The compact, aluminum and EMI-shielded case further enhances the durability, making it ideal for various challenging environments.

Equipped with USB 3.0 data link, the Fobos SDR ensures easy device connectivity and quick data transfer. Strong and robust USB 3.0 Type B plug provides sufficient power delivery and gives extra commutation durability.

We provide software support for Fobos SDR including lightweight open source API library, compatibility libraries and wrappers for SDRSharp plugin, SoapySDR, GNURadio, SDR++, HDSDR ExtIO, application software examples for C, C++, C#, Pascal (Delphi). Windows and Linux operation systems supported. All source codes are available on our GitHub page and provided with LGPL-2.1 license. This is the best quick start kit for other software development, education and evaluation.

For quick start and easy to use we provide a portable software distributions of SDRSharp, SDR++ and HDSDR with Fobos SDR support configured and ready to run. The earliest versions could be downloaded from our server right now. Full native API support is implemented in μSDR v.1.7.1 and higher, which is preferable to use see with Fobos SDR.
